Boont Amber Ale

In another round of raiding the local Trader Joe's market down the street (a chain of stores that doesn't care if you break up a six-pack to purchase singles), I grabbed this Anderson Valley Amber Ale on a whim. And although it took a while for me to warm up to this, I'm glad I stuck it out. Tasty, indeed.

Even when I had served this entirely too cold, the aroma was nice and floral, showing off both the malt and the hops in the nose. Of course, once I let it warm up to proper ale-like temperatures, things certianly improved.

Same-same for the flavor profile. While at first I didn't really kare for the semi-sweet maltiness of the finish, things balanced out for the better with some time and paitence. That is to say, the hops caught up to the malt as the beer warmed up a touch, providing the finished product a much more interesting vibe.

But while I can't say that this is my favorite American Amber Ale -- still a bit harsh in the mouthfeel and drinkability, IMO -- it is worth checking out for the bargain-basement prices I see it being sold for. And with all of the Anderson Valley beers that I've had so far, even their most medicore efforts are better than many other breweries from around the country.

Recommended.
